摘要
Precisely controlling the shape of a flexible object during animation is a time-consuming job for the computer animator and there does not yet exist a method which is universally applicable. The paper describes a system which models the objects interactively using a "point and click" paradigm, which is analogous to manipulating a clay object by hand, rather than the conventional "pick and drag" approach. Thus, the modelling process can be regarded as "virtual sculpting" The two-handed operation of the system takes place in a stereoscopic environment. To support the process, an extension to NURBS, called CISSes, was developed and the mathematical background to this is described Tests of a prototype system were undertaken with a range of users, as a result of which further mathematical extensions were necessary. The resulting system is described.
